Hyderabad Institute for Technology and Management Sciences successfully convened its 2nd Academic Council Meeting

Hyderabad Institute for Technology and Management Sciences successfully convened its 2nd Academic Council Meeting under the chairmanship of the Worthy Rector, Prof. Dr. Saeeduddin Shaikh. The meeting was held to deliberate upon important academic and institutional matters in line with the institute’s commitment to academic excellence, quality enhancement, and institutional development.

The proceedings of the meeting were conducted by Prof. Dr. Iqleem Haider Taqvi, Registrar of HITMS, who served as Secretary to the Academic Council, while Dr. Zahoor Hussain Shah, Dean FCET and Academic Head, presented the academic agenda before the honorable members of the council.

During the session, the Academic Council considered and approved various academic matters, curriculum frameworks, institutional policies, and the introduction of new undergraduate programs in emerging and multidisciplinary fields.

The meeting was attended by distinguished external members, including Prof. Dr. Ali Raza Jaffri from NED University of Engineering and Technology, Prof. Dr. Naseem from Sir Syed University of Engineering and Technology, Prof. Dr. Zafar Siddique from Isra University, and Prof. Dr. Mubashir Khan from NED University of Engineering and Technology, who also participated online.

The internal members included Prof. Dr. Iqleem Haider Taqvi , Registrar;Dr. Zahoor Hussain Shah, Dean FCET and Academic Head; Mr. Shahbaz, Assistant Controller of Examinations; Mr. Rizwan Hussain, D.D CMS; Mr. Rashid Rao from the Library Department; and Miss Rashida, Co-opted Member and Program Coordinator for Computer Science. Mr. Mukhtiar Rajput, Director Finance, also attended the meeting online.

The successful conduct of the 2nd Academic Council Meeting reflects the continued commitment of HITMS towards strengthening academic standards, fostering innovation, and advancing quality higher education in the region.
